The Chambers Island Nature Preserve has now grown to nearly 700 acres of hardwood forests and wetlands. The Door County Land Trust announced the donation of nine-acres of land previously adjacent to the preserve by Pete and Fawn Rogers of Appleton. Pete Rogers says he sees it as a gift for both people and wildlife.
Door County Land Trust Land Program Director Julie Shartner says such a donation is helping the group reach a lofty goal.
Schartner says the trust is working with other Chambers Island property owners and expects to acquire more lands in 2019.
